ApexSQL Source Control: ApexSQL Source Control is a version control system designed specifically for database developers. It allows tracking changes, comparing versions, and rolling back unwanted modifications to SQL Server, Oracle, MySQL, PostgreSQL, and MariaDB databases.

dbForge Source Control for SQL Server: dbForge Source Control for SQL Server is a source control plugin for SQL Server that allows version control, restoring, comparing, and backing up SQL Server databases and objects. It integrates with popular version control systems like Git, Azure DevOps, and others.

Key Features Comparison

ApexSQL Source Control
ApexSQL Source Control Features
  • Integrates with SQL Server Management Studio (SSMS) and Visual Studio
  • Supports version control for SQL Server, Oracle, MySQL, PostgreSQL, and MariaDB databases
  • Provides a visual diff tool to compare database objects and scripts
  • Allows rollback of unwanted changes to the database
  • Supports branching, merging, and conflict resolution
  • Provides a web-based interface for remote team collaboration
  • Includes a built-in backup and restore functionality
  • Supports automated database deployment and continuous integration
dbForge Source Control for SQL Server
dbForge Source Control for SQL Server Features
  • Version control of database objects like tables, views, stored procedures
  • Integration with Git, SVN, TFS, Azure DevOps
  • Compare and synchronize database schemas
  • Roll back changes and restore previous versions
  • Centralized backup storage
  • Web interface for remote access
